"Went on the boat tour/snorkel of the Na Pali coast with my husband after finding a lot of other places had been booked up. We found this place the day before and booked it as they had openings. When we checked in the next day there were no issues and there is a bathroom on site before you leave too, as you meet them at the harbor. We were on the Na Pali Explorer II which is a pretty big boat and it does have a bathroom since the tour was about 4 hours. They also give you dry bags to put your stuff in. Captain Kevin was awesome, he knew a lot of the history of Kauai and had a good sense of humor. The waves were a bit choppy, but he handled them easily and it seemed only a couple people got sick. The deck hands Janessa (sp?) and Drake were also super cool. Janessa even took a really good video for us of the dolphins we encountered using our GoPro and Drake took nice pictures of my husband and I as we stopped along the Na Pali coast, even offering tidbits of fact on his own here and there. Because of the choppy waves, none of the snorkel spots were safe to swim so they took us to another location just for swimming purposes, but there were no fish around, just clear open ocean. Even though I wanted to snorkel, they can't control the weather and honestly I felt that the trip was worth it even though we didn't get to snorkel. The lunch provided was also very good, your standard deli meat sandwiches. This tour was one of my favorite things on this trip, I would recommend it to anyone."
